Champ is used in Self-titled’s branding for Hoopla to bring a playful, versatile voice to the family entertainment centers. The typeface is scaled and adapted across the logo, communications, and digital platforms, helping express the brand’s promise of “Entertainment Unlimited” while remaining clear and engaging on mobile devices. Secondary text is in Degular and Degular Mono.
